The Elizabethton Cyclones will start the 2015 season ranked inside the Tennessee prep AP polls.

The Cyclones will kick off 2015 ranked seventh in the Class 3A poll. Elizabethton is coming off an 8-3 season, which ended in the first round of the playoffs with a loss at Knoxville Catholic. It will be a different season as Elizabethton has to replace Ethan Thomas and also has to fill the void left by an injury to Caleb Jones.

However, the Cyclones have plenty of firepower and look to make a run. Elizabethton, however, won’t kick off the 2015 season until Week 2 when they travel to Science Hill.

In Class 2A, Hampton received votes, but was not ranked inside the top 10. The Bulldogs return plenty of firepower from last season’s 9-2 campaign, including quarterback Coby Jones and running back duo Adam McClain and Jerry Lunsford. New region foe Gatlinburg-Pittman was ranked 10th in the poll. 

The Bulldogs will kick off the 2015 season on Friday night at Avery County (N.C.).
